  2. M.U.L.E. Returns -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/M.U.L.E._Returns

    The gameplay of M.U.L.E. Returns closely follows that of the original M.U.L.E., though the controls are adapted for mobile device touchscreens. [1] Improvements over the original include a pause feature, three difficulty modes, social media integration, and the ability to apply custom skins.

  5. Sentinel Returns -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Sentinel_Returns

    Sentinel Returns is a video game developed by Hookstone, produced by No-Name Games and published by Sony (under the Psygnosis label) in 1998, for Microsoft Windows and PlayStation.   9. Function (computer programming)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Function_(computer...

    In computer programming, a function (also procedure, method, subroutine, routine, or subprogram) is a callable unit [1] of software logic that has a well-defined interface and behavior and can be invoked multiple times.
